ISEP Location
International Student Exchange Program (ISEP) offers
programs in 50 countries. Qualified St.
Lawrence students may study at any ISEP international member
institution. In the recent past, St. Lawrence students have studied at the
following institutions through ISEP:

Pontificia Universidad Católica de Valparaíso - CHILE
Students live with host families on this program, and may take courses from
across the curriculum at Valparaiso. Completion of 5 semesters of Spanish (or
equivalent) is required prior to participation.
Södertörn University- SWEDEN
ISEP offers several institutions in Sweden, Sodertorn is located in a suburb of
Stockholm and offers more than 80 classes taught in English each semester.
Students live as Swedish students do: in student residences in the city of
Huddinge.
